Is it fair to portray Jerry Krause, architect of the Jordan-era Bulls, as a villain?

By Los Angeles Times

Luckily, the man who built the team of the 1990s was also the person responsible for knocking it down, and unlike Mrs. O’Leary’s clumsy cow, Chicago Bulls general manager Krause set this fire on purpose.

In the first two episodes of “The Last Dance” we hear Krause celebrate Phil Jackson’s most recent, one-year contract with the team by reminding the press Jackson wouldn’t be back the following season. We learn of Krause’s fishing trip with Tim Floyd and the baffling decision to invite Floyd (and not Jackson) to a family wedding that other members of the organization attended.

We see him try to grab his piece of adoration for the Bulls’ success, seemingly speaking directly to Michael Jordan when he says that organizations win titles — not players. We see him belittled, disrespected by his star players for being too short and too chubby.

And we learn that Scottie Pippen, fed up with Krause, not only delayed a foot surgery but also berated Krause on a team bus in front of the rest of the Bulls.
